In re Juan A., D064890

In this juvenile criminal proceeding, true findings for resisting a police officer and for disturbing the peace are reversed, where: 1) the Minor yielded immediately upon police demand, and that he did not want to talk to the officer before that point was not a criminal act; 2) loud shouting or noise by itself is not enough to be criminal conduct - it must be coupled with a clear and present danger of violence or specifically designed to disturb persons; and 3) the prosecution therefore failed to prove the elements of either offense.
